Her infectious laugh fills cars, offices and homes all across Malaysia every weekday morning. The voice behind Hitz.Fm’s “gettin’ down and dirty” celebrity gossips, Fay dishes her home living habits and styles with us in an exclusive interview for our first ever ‘Revamp’ issue.

Google three letters: F-A-Y. Click on nothing and see the name that comes up at the top of the list. Ms. Hokulani, a model, host, writer, fitness junkie and Malaysia’s reason to want to be stuck in a jam, packs a lot more than a powerful punch in her hands. Her reputable charms and professions aside, Fay is a homebody with a mild case of OCD. “When I was 7 years old, I’d clean the house instead of playing with Barbie,” says the multi-cultural Singaporean. “I like when things are clean—everything organized, magazines stacked in order.” With a busy schedule to upkeep, it’s a bit wondrous how Fay transforms into her own housemaid. “It’s not a juggling act at all. I prefer to stay home and I spend a lot of time at the gym, which my loft has.”

Fay’s Interior Cues
1 Shelves and storage spaces are musts. They are lifesavers and help minimize clutter. Things that are kept out of sight are less distracting than something left right out in the open. This also applies to containers.

2 Give leather a try. Hokulani was never a fan of leather couches until it moved into her home. Now she’s in love with the sofa she once thought gave off psychiatric vibes.

3 Once upon a time she rearranged her room’s furniture and was advised that it’s bad ‘Feng Shui’ to place the bed directly in front of the door. That very night, the wall that held her T.V., hanging clock and shelf caught on fire. Since then, she’s been a Feng Shui advocate.

4 Make sure the living room area has everything you’ll need within arms’ reach. Fay spends a majority of her time in the living, so it’s important to her to have all the technologies she’ll need within easy access.


Fay’s first passion is fitness and since starting her blog, withlovefay.com, the 24 year old has since inspired many Singaporean and Malaysian women to live healthy, look good. Currently, Fay stays in a loft near Kuala Lumpur which offers everything she could have asked for. “There’s an awesome gym where I live, two in fact: cardio upstairs, equipment downstairs. They have a pool with underwater music, a cafeteria that sends food to order to your apartment, and a mini-mart. I never have to leave my building,” she shares excitedly. The inside of her home is simplistic. It came semi-furnished so there was little she had to personally account for. However, she managed to add little touches of herself into the two-bedroom apartment. “The first object I wanted in my house was a big picture of a beach,” she says. “I don’t like the city, the traffic or all the lights. I’m an island girl.”
Hokulani’s blog started back in 2008 but didn’t take off until late 2009. Now she averages roughly 1,500+ hits per day, which keeps her inspired and motivated to update as much as possible. And perhaps there’s one thing not many know about Fay: She’s the art director and designer behind the entire layout and content of her successful blog. “I love design because it’s unrestricted. You get to be creative,” she says. “Design is personal, so when people start telling you how best to do it, it’s a bit crushing.”

Fay translates her passion for the arts and fine living into her living quarters. No matter where she may go in the future, you can be sure there will be a big portrait of a beach hanging as a feature wall, and a hint of lavender in the little things.
